Brian Conway is a scholar working on Virology, Infectious Diseases and Computer Networks and Communications. According to data from OpenAlex, Brian Conway has authored 8 papers receiving a total of 932 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 7 papers in Virology, 6 papers in Infectious Diseases and 1 paper in Computer Networks and Communications. Recurrent topics in Brian Conway’s work include HIV Research and Treatment (7 papers), HIV/AIDS drug development and treatment (6 papers) and HIV/AIDS Research and Interventions (3 papers). Brian Conway is often cited by papers focused on HIV Research and Treatment (7 papers), HIV/AIDS drug development and treatment (6 papers) and HIV/AIDS Research and Interventions (3 papers). Brian Conway collaborates with scholars based in Canada, United States and Netherlands. Brian Conway's co-authors include Marianne Harris, Mark A. Wainberg, Maureen Myers, David B. Hall, Stefano Vella, Peter Reiß, Patrick Robinson, Julio Montaner, Danielle M. Smith and David A. Cooper and has published in prestigious journals such as JAMA, Clinical Infectious Diseases and AIDS.
